Output cdfdfa2afc3feb1d6fb8f56abe4699d52dfd88255be819ec4c2ca655a3a26e4a:0

value
512825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b8cd20c79733b6dac48ef58072cb9a9a8789dc3 OP_EQUAL
address
34Cgs6wZtp7E55SFNVtMV31surht8kQvLt
transaction
cdfdfa2afc3feb1d6fb8f56abe4699d52dfd88255be819ec4c2ca655a3a26e4a
confirmations
353998
spent
true